How to Make Roasted Potatoes and Onions - Easy and Delicious - A Step-by-Step Guide

Roasted potatoes and onions are a classic side dish that never fails to please a crowd. The crispiness of the potatoes, the sweetness of the onions, and the savory flavors from the herbs and spices make this dish a standout. Plus, it's incredibly easy to make and requires minimal effort, making it the perfect addition to any meal.

Ingredients

  • 2 pounds potatoes, sliced into 1/2-inch-thick pieces
  • 1 onion, halved and each half cut into quarters
  • ½ cup canola oil
  • ½ cup olive oil
  • 4 cloves garlic, chopped
  • 1 envelope onion soup mix
  • 1 tablespoon chopped fresh rosemary, or more to taste
  • 1 tablespoon freshly ground black pepper

Information

  • Prep Time: 15 mins
  • Cook Time: 40 mins
  • Total Time: 55 mins
  • Servings: 6

  • Preheat the oven to 450 degrees F (230 degrees C).
  • Combine potatoes and onion in a roasting pan; cover with canola oil and olive oil. Add garlic, onion soup mix, rosemary, and black pepper; stir until potatoes and onion are evenly coated. Cover roasting pan with aluminum foil.
  • Roast in the preheated oven for 25 minutes. Remove foil and continue to roast until potatoes and onion are browned and edges are crispy, 15 to 30 minutes.
